Penn State Season Opener At Purdue Will Be Televised On Fox

On Monday, it was announced that Penn State’s season opener at Purdue schedule for Thursday, Sept. 1, will be televised on FOX. The time has yet to be announced. 

The network gained rights to the game due to letting long-time play-by-play announcer Joe Buck out of his contract to join the ESPN Monday Night Football broadcast team continuing his partnership with Troy Aikman.

Fox Sports received an extra pick from the Big Ten’s 2022-2023 football slate and chose the Penn State-Purdue game. Fox will have 28 games on its Big Ten Football Slate, and ESPN will have 26 games.

In a deal struck by Jimmy Pitaro of Disney and Fox Sports president Eric Shanks, ESPN relinquished the rights to the Sept. 1 window of games. ESPN will be broadcasting the West Virginia-Pitt matchup taking place on the same night.

Penn State-Purdue was originally scheduled for Saturday, Sept. 3, but was moved up to Sept. 1 last month.

 Penn State will open its season with a road conference game for the third consecutive year.

The Nittany Lions lost to Indiana in 2020 and beat Wisconsin at Camp Randall Stadium last season.

Penn State leads the all-time series with Purdue  15-3-1, last playing in 2019 when Penn State won 35-7. Penn State last visited Purdue in 2016 and routed the Boilermakers 62-24.
